首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

谷歌OAuth不断失败

谷歌OAuth是一种用于授权和认证的开放标准,允许用户通过谷歌账号登录和授权第三方应用程序访问其谷歌账号信息。当用户尝试使用谷歌OAuth登录时,可能会遇到授权失败的情况。以下是可能导致谷歌OAuth失败的一些常见原因和解决方法:

  1. 无效的客户端凭证:谷歌OAuth授权过程中需要使用有效的客户端凭证(Client ID和Client Secret)。确保在使用谷歌OAuth时提供了正确的凭证,并且这些凭证与应用程序和身份验证服务器配置一致。
  2. 未正确配置重定向URL:在使用谷歌OAuth时,必须提供正确的重定向URL,以便在授权成功或失败后将用户重定向回应用程序。确保在谷歌开发者控制台中正确配置了重定向URL,并确保应用程序代码中的重定向URL与配置一致。
  3. 用户拒绝授权:用户可能会拒绝授权第三方应用程序访问其谷歌账号信息。在处理授权失败时,应提供友好的提示,以便用户了解授权的重要性,并可以重新尝试授权。
  4. 令牌过期或撤销:谷歌OAuth授权令牌有时限,可能会过期。如果令牌过期或被用户主动撤销,需要相应的处理逻辑,重新获取或提示用户重新授权。
  5. 网络连接问题:授权过程涉及与谷歌服务器的通信,网络连接问题可能导致授权失败。在处理授权失败时,应考虑网络连接问题,并提供适当的错误处理和用户反馈。
  6. 应用程序权限不足:在访问某些敏感用户数据或执行某些操作时,应用程序可能需要特定的权限。确保应用程序已经获得了所需的权限,并在授权过程中正确请求这些权限。

总的来说,谷歌OAuth授权失败可能是由多种原因导致的,包括无效的凭证、配置错误、用户拒绝授权、令牌问题、网络连接问题以及权限不足等。在处理授权失败时,开发人员应仔细检查和排除可能的错误,并提供友好的用户体验和错误处理。对于谷歌OAuth授权,腾讯云提供了云身份认证服务(Cloud Identity)来帮助开发人员管理用户身份认证和授权,详情请参考:腾讯云云身份认证服务介绍

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

干货 | 通过不断失败来避免失败,携程混沌工程实践

混沌工程的核心思想是通过不断失败来避免失败,以主动制造故障的方法来宏观地验证业务的容灾和恢复能力。本文讨论了携程在实践混沌工程以来的想法和方案,希望能带来一些参考和启发。...一、我们为什么要做混沌工程 这几年,携程业务和技术架构在不断地快速演进,给服务可用性提出了很大的挑战:系统的宕机成本越来越高,用户对故障的容忍度越来越低。...而混沌工程就是这样一个外部的力量,当我们不断地在运行实验时,程序员们不得不思考如何让自己开发的服务在各种混沌实验场景中活下去。...最后,要做好混沌工程必须不畏惧失败,能悲观地想象各种风险和隐患,并谨慎、乐观地探索和验证,用不断失败来避免更大的失败

94920

使用OAuth 2.0访问谷歌的API

使用OAuth 2.0访问谷歌的API 谷歌的API使用的OAuth 2.0协议进行身份验证和授权。谷歌支持常见的OAuth 2.0场景,如那些Web服务器,安装,和客户端应用程序。...首先,获得来自OAuth 2.0用户端凭证谷歌API控制台。那么你的客户端应用程序请求从谷歌授权服务器的访问令牌,提取令牌从响应,并发送令牌到谷歌的API,您要访问。...对于使用OAuth 2.0与谷歌的互动演示(包括利用自己的客户端证书的选项),实验用的OAuth 2.0游乐场。...该页面提供的OAuth 2.0用户授权方案的概述,谷歌的支持,并提供链接到更详细的内容。有关使用OAuth 2.0认证的详细信息,请参阅ID连接。...基本步骤 访问使用OAuth 2.0谷歌的API时,所有的应用程序都遵循一个基本模式。在高层次上,你遵循四个步骤: 1.获取的OAuth谷歌API控制台2.0凭据。

4.5K10

失败成就伟大:谷歌的23个失败案例

选文 | Aileen 翻译 | 蒋晔 校对 | 范玥灿 一路上不押注于几次失败,你是不可能成为一个像谷歌这样的互联网巨头。 企业创新是艰难的。...◆ ◆ ◆ 谷歌眼镜(Google Glass),2011-2015 谷歌早就推出了可穿戴设备,即谷歌眼镜,一种能够在用户面前放置电脑的未来目镜。...2015年1月,谷歌表示停止生产谷歌眼镜的原型,但并没有完全废弃该项目。同年12月,谷歌向FCC提交了一份关于谷歌眼镜新版本的新申请,表明其最终可能会重新推出谷歌眼镜。...评论家指责Lively的失败在其仅有窗口模式和缺乏市场营销。...◆ ◆ ◆ Google Offers, 2011 – 2014 Google看到了Groupon团购热潮的成功,并且在企图收购这个日常交易公司失败后,决定使用Google Offers打入交易空间。

2.4K10

谷歌大脑AutoML最新进展:不断进化的阿米巴网络

有没有什么方法,训练出一个据外界环境的变化,像阿米巴变形虫那样即时调整出最优的生存策略,不断自我进化获取最优结果的算法呢? 自进化的AmoebaNet 还真的有。...谷歌本身有强大的算力优势。所以谷歌大脑团队在琢磨,除了采用强化学习这种方法,怎么样才能能让图像分类器的迭代速度加快。 迭代速度快还不够,出来的效果也必须好,最好还不需要重度依赖专家。...这就是谷歌大脑要AmoebaNet满足的三个点。...25讲视频全集在此 谷歌开源语义图像分割模型DeepLab-v3+ | 附代码 首个72量子比特的量子计算机问世,谷歌出品 破解AI大脑黑盒迈出新一步!...谷歌现在更懂机器,还开源了研究工具 DIY发现新行星操作指南 | 谷歌开源了行星发现代码 绿幕通通扔掉 ੧ᐛ੭ | 谷歌AI实时「抠」背景

46751

不断去搜索点击自己的网站,能提升谷歌SEO排名吗

Google SEO是啥.png 那么,不断去搜索点击自己的网站,能提升谷歌SEO排名吗 根据以往谷歌SEO观察的经验,一尘SEO,将通过如下内容阐述:   1、排名提升 我们经常会讲,但一个网站在SERP...如果仅仅是自己偶尔平时检索一下,并且点击目标网站的话,我们认为对于谷歌排名提升没有任何作用。  ...2、利于抓取 如果你是刚进入谷歌SEO这个领域,有的时候我们在查看一些谷歌SEO教程的时候,经常会看到某些课程,会讲,平时自己每隔一定时间去点击一下自己的关键词排名。  ...确实会造成系统误伤,解决这个问题的方法也非常简单,你只需要反馈给谷歌官方就可以在1-2周内,得到排名有效的恢复。  ...谷歌SEO https://www.dustseo.com/

1.5K117

谷歌历史上18项失败的产品

然而在10年之前,Google X 这个名字还曾经被用在一项失败的产品上面。2005年推出的Google X试图在搜索引擎主页上加入和苹果Mac OS X一样的Dock栏,把谷歌所有的产品列在上面。...谷歌问答(Google Answers)(存活时间:2002年至2006年) 2002年,谷歌推出了名为谷歌问答(Google Answers) 的新服务。...谷歌问答其实是针对雅虎知识 (Yahoo Answers)推出的一项服务,然而后者是免费的,谷歌则需要支付不菲的费用,最终谷歌在2006年关闭了这项服务。...谷歌目录搜索(Google Catalog Search)(存活时间:2002年至2009年) 和谷歌问答一样,谷歌目录搜索同样是谷歌对于搜索引擎业务未来发展方向的一次错误理解。...该应用2005年被谷歌收购,之后一直无所作为,最终于2009年被谷歌关闭,谷歌也推出了谷歌纵横(Google Latitude)来替代这款应用。

1.5K120

谷歌任命首席隐官,应对美国政府不断施加的监管压力

谷歌将实现消费者有权更正、删除自己的个人数据或者将数据以机器可读的格式导出。...自Facebook爆发泄露用户数据事件后,科技巨头们在隐私数据安全等方面持续不断的面临着来自政府不断施加的压力,欧盟和美国政府都要求Facebook、谷歌等科技巨头采取更多的防护措施处理用户的个人信息。...此前,谷歌和很多技术公司一样对政府的监管较为抵制,但随着政策的收紧。日前,谷歌发布的一个数据保护立法框架中,其公司接受了一些最低限度的监管以及政府制定的一些新规定。 ?...谷歌欢迎并支持全面的基础隐私保护监管。” 本次,谷歌在隐私问题上制定的企业战略,还包括与第三方分享数据的相关规定。...谷歌提出,要让与外界“处理公司”分享数据的企业承担法律规定的一些义务,包括透明度、控制权以及信息获取权限,并且,由处理公司负责隐私安全。

24520

谷歌浏览器安装插件失败的解决方案

谷歌浏览器安装插件失败的解决方案 1、把 crx 后缀名文件改为 zip 或者 rar 文件(即强制改成压缩文件) ?...3、在谷歌浏览器中 点击右上角的三点图标 - 更多工具 - 扩展程序 ? 4、选择开发模式,点击 加载已解压的扩展程序 ,选择刚刚解压的文件 确定 ? ? 5、安装之后最好把开发模式关了 ?...不然每次打开谷歌浏览器它都会给你来一个这个提示 ? 结语:谷歌官网国内已经不能再访问了,正版的谷歌浏览器插件需要科学上网才能下载。谷歌浏览器对第三方插件是不允许使用的。...但是又不想科学上网的小伙伴们可以通过修改文件格式的方法安装第三方的谷歌浏览器插件。

2.3K20

「视频」Magic Leap会是第二个失败的“谷歌眼镜”吗?

这不由得让人联想起之前备受瞩目的谷歌眼镜。Forrester的分析师JP Gownder表示,谷歌推出的谷歌眼镜之时所面临的诸多问题可以很轻易地转化给Magic Leap。...谷歌眼镜推出后,面临了一系列未曾预料的问题,比如个人隐私问题、社会歧视问题等。这一系列非技术问题,Magic Leap也有机会“感同身受”。...其次,Magic Leap的佩戴者可能会遭受到其他一些人的嗤之以鼻,很典型的例子就是——佩戴谷歌眼镜的人被其他人视为花1500美元买玩具的神经病,并被戏称为Glassholes。...另外,如同谷歌眼镜没有消费者想象中的那么神奇,Magic Leap也可能会遭受同样的尴尬。 所以,Magic Leap所必须克服的不仅是技术上的难题,还有真正投入使用之后的市场问题。

59660

谷歌解释了最近 YouTube 和 Gmail 宕机的原因

谷歌表示,周一影响大多数面向消费者系列的全球认证系统中断是由于自动配额管理系统中的一个 bug 影响了谷歌用户 ID 服务。 这个全球性的系统故障使得用户无法登录到他们的帐户并验证所有的云服务。...停机影响和根本原因 “2020年12月14日星期一,美国/太平洋时间3:46到4:33,所有谷歌用户账户的凭证发放和账户元数据查找失败,”谷歌解释说。”...全球身份管理系统 谷歌用户识别服务是周一谷歌宕机事件的根源,它为所有谷歌账户存储唯一的标识符,并管理 OAuth 令牌和 cookies 的身份验证凭据。...由于用户识别服务出于安全原因在检测到过时数据时会拒绝请求,所有需要 Google OAuth 访问的面向用户的谷歌服务在服务开始出现问题并开始发出过时的识别码后就无法使用。...“谷歌使用一套不断发展的自动化工具来管理分配给服务的各种资源的配额,”该公司在今天发布的一份摘要报告中表示。

1.8K10

升级springboot 2.6.x springcloud 2021.0.x 导致oauth2sso客户端登录失败

现象 oauth2客户端,授权服务器依赖版本升级 spring-boot:2.5.5升级到2.6.8 spring-cloud:2020.0.4升级到2021.0.3 授权服务器使用spring-cloud-starter-oauth2...:2.2.5搭建 客户端申请访问令牌失败,授权服务器产生客户端证书错误异常事件 原因 spring-boot:2.5.5 对应spring-security:5.5.2 spring-boot 2.6.8...,导致授权服务校验客户端失败 源码分析 spring-security-oauth2-client:5.6.5 尝试获取认证令牌 org.springframework.security.oauth2...= new OAuth2Error("invalid_state_parameter"); throw new OAuth2AuthorizationException(oauth2Error...... } 转换BasicAuthentication请求 默认的转换器只对请求Authorization头部信息做base64解码,并没有进行urldecode,导致证书信息没有正确还原,校验失败

1.3K20

试图摆脱谷歌的算法制约?DeepMind欲「自立门户」,但宣告失败

谷歌的人工智能部门DeepMind多年来一直在与母公司Alphabet谈判,希望获得更多自主权,为人工智能的研究寻求一个独立的法律架构。 然而DeepMind在上月末告诉员工,谷歌取消了相关谈判。...以数量取胜的尝试失败了。 我们把白人换成白色的动物,这样算法总可以正确地识别了吧? 实际结果却令人大跌眼镜。 算法在白色面前,连人都不认了? 那我们都换成动物呢? 全是动物也这么夸张?...试图脱离来自谷歌的制约 DeepMind成立于2010年,其目标是构建先进的人工智能系统,并于2014年被谷歌收购。...谷歌在算法伦理上的缺失 2016年,谷歌成立了一个监督DeepMind Health的委员会。成立两个月后,DeepMind Health承认在没有告知的情况下,查看了英国160万患者的记录。...当年11月,谷歌宣布将DeepMind Health的著名医疗应用程序Streams给各地护士和医生使用,而这引起了英国公共卫生界对隐私的担忧,因为谷歌和DeepMind之前保证不会共享健康记录。

21710

WordZ:Word终结者,基于Google API的文档自动化 电子合同发票流水账单线上集成方案

, 这里是阮一峰的博客,大家可以用来参考 官方关于OAuth2.0在谷歌API中的使用 我翻译的中文文档 在清楚了OAuth2.0后,我就知道了为什么调用一些接口报没有权限。...据说可以使用postman 调试谷歌API,但我试了几次都没成功。...这里便是Google的API库,你可以随意挑选, google-api-javascript-client 使用js调用接口,必须要了解一些这个库,这个是谷歌的一个开源库 地址 库里介绍了如何初始化OAuth2.0...下面我就找几个比较典型的问题来和大家分享一下 典型问题1:Google JS API 授权 失败 在调用API时,为了格式整齐,漂亮,将一部分授权代码这样写了 // 初始化OAuth2.0授权...导致授权失败 代码无法正常运行,虽然不报错。让我头疼了一会 头疼指为2,我仔细对比了demo的代码。demo代码如下 发现除了格式和换行,真的没有没有什么区别了啊。

4.2K30

谷歌挖来Twitter机器学习大牛,甲骨文收购不断势要将亚马逊拽下“神坛” | 大数据24小时

二、谷歌挖来Twitter机器学习大牛,任加拿大最新人工智能实验室负责人 近日消息,谷歌位于加拿大第二大城市蒙特利尔的人工智能实验室宣布正式成立,未来实验室将专注于机器学习方面的研究工作,而其负责人就是前不久谷歌刚刚从...拉罗歇尔毕业于蒙特利尔大学,并获得机器学习博士学位,曾就职于美国著名社交网站Twitter,在机器学习、人工智能领域拥有丰富经验,目前他的首要任务还是早日打造出一支技术过硬的团队,未来该团队也将成为“谷歌大脑...三、云计算领域“厮杀”惨烈,甲骨文收购不断势要将亚马逊拽下“神坛” 说到如今的云计算领域,用“厮杀惨烈”来形容一点也不为过,尤其是燃烧在亚马逊、谷歌、微软、甲骨文几大巨头之间的战火从未熄灭过。

1.2K60

配置Gridea客户端的踩雷全经历

随后同步又出了问题,显示同步失败,请到FAQ或者联系作者解决(总算有了帮助界面,而且刚才远程连接的错误在里面就有却没有提示指引我去看那里),同样打开“Edit→开发者工具→console”,显示的异常如下图...: 双击“message”便能看到所有报错信息,复制粘贴出来看就好(甚至可以复制到谷歌翻译上方便理解): 我这里出的问题是邮箱私有了,导致无法正确执行git命令,在github设置后...App,步骤如下: ①在Github右上角点自己的头像,点“setting” ②点击“Developer settings”,点击“OAuth Apps”→“New OAuth Apps”...gitalk部分,OAuth App中需要修改的有两个部分,一个是Homepage URL,可以自己随便建一个仓库,填入仓库所在地址就行,一个是Authorization callback URL,需要填自己的...Coding Pages的域名(区分http和https),然后Gridea中仓库一栏填自己OAuth App中用的仓库名,owner填建立仓库所用的Github账号的username。

1.4K20

OAuth 2.0 for Client-side Web Applications

OAuth 2.0的客户端Web应用程序 本文介绍了如何从一个JavaScript的Web应用程序实现的OAuth 2.0授权访问谷歌的API。...创建授权证书 任何应用程序使用OAuth 2.0访问谷歌的API必须具有识别应用到谷歌OAuth 2.0服务器授权证书。下面的步骤说明如何为项目创建的凭据。...获得的OAuth 2.0访问令牌 下列步骤显示了与谷歌OAuth 2.0服务器应用程序交互如何获得用户的同意执行代表用户的API请求。...步骤4:处理OAuth 2.0服务器响应 JS客户端库 OAuth 2.0用户端点 JavaScript客户端库处理来自谷歌的授权服务器的响应。...您也可以撤销通过访问应用程序 的权限为您的谷歌帐户页面。该应用程序被列为OAuth 2.0用户演示了谷歌API文档。

2.2K10

假冒App引发的新网络钓鱼威胁

5月3日,有100万Gmail用户收到自己的某个邮箱联系人发来的假冒谷歌文档分享请求并遭受攻击。从表面上看,可能这只是一封普通的钓鱼邮件,没什么大不了。...世界上许多顶级在线服务供应商依赖于OAuth,包括谷歌、微软、雅虎、推特、脸书等。...因此,即使企业试图阻止黑客利用OAuth特权的特定攻击——就像谷歌对5月3日谷歌文档诈骗所做的那样——并没有真正解决整体问题,而且类似的攻击可能会一次又一次地重演。...撇去各种术语,简单来说OAuth是一种让互联网用户无需共享密码即可将第三方应用添加到现有的在线服务(如谷歌、脸书和推特)的方式。...问题在于,如果黑客可以欺骗谷歌、雅虎、脸书、推特或其他服务接受恶意app,他可以利用这种信任关系并劫持个人帐户。

1.2K50

Asp.net Core IdentityServer4 入门教程(一):概念解析

是使用 ASP.NET Core实现了OpenID和OAuth 2.0协议的身份认证框架;重复一遍,它是一个框架;框架决定它不是一个开箱即用的产品,需要根据自己的需求进行定制;同时也意味着更高的灵活性...以上就是一个典型的OAuth过程 ?...OAuth 2.0是OAuth 1.0出现安全漏洞后修补了协议( 2.0具体协议RC 6749)的一个版本,与概念是什么无关; OAuth 2.0和OAuth 1.0不兼容; 3、IdentityServer4...不同的部门对调用同一个业务的权限又不一样;这个时候IdentityServer4就很容易实现以上需求了; (3)支持OpenID登录 IdentityServer4是支持OpenID登录的框架,比如谷歌是...OpenID的提供者,登录谷歌就直接使用第二点提到的使用谷歌 OpenID登录就可以登录了; (4)统一的登录处理逻辑 比如你们公司有有多个业务后台系统需要登录,每个后台单独使用一套用户名和密码将非常麻烦

3.1K31
领券